Material Changes and Litigation Outcome
- Appeal Decision: The U.S.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it affirmed the District Court's judgment that U.S. Patent Nos. 11,091,439, 11,091,440, and 11,098,015 are not invalid.
- Patent No. 11,298,349: The Court dismissed MSN Laboratories' appeal regarding this patent as moot and vacated the district court's decision on this specific issue. This patent expires on February 10, 2032.
- Generic Launch Impact: Based on the decision, the effective date for FDA approval of MSN's Abbreviated New Drug Application (ANDA) cannot be earlier than January 15, 2030 (the expiration date of the affirmed patents).
Outlook, Risks, and Contingencies
- Future Litigation: The January 15, 2030 date is subject to the outcome of separate litigation involving U.S. Patent No. 12,128,039 (expiring February 2032), with a trial scheduled to begin in November 2026.
- Regulatory Factors: The timeline is also subject to applicable regulatory exclusivity and further appellate proceedings.
